Benno Meaning and Origin
Benno is a masculine name that, despite its listing under Native American origins, functions primarily as a Germanic short form of Benedict or Bernard, meaning "bear" or "blessed." The name has two syllables, pronounced BEH-no, and carries a warm, solid, slightly old-fashioned charm. It suits a confident, sturdy male cat with a distinctive character.
- Rooted in Germanic languages, variant of Benedict or Bernard
- Meaning: "bear" or "blessed"
- Pronounced BEH-no, two syllables
- Masculine in feel with a friendly, approachable sound
